There are many neutral particles which are made up of charged quarks e.g. the neutron) but the only fundamental neutral particles are neutrinos, photons, Z bosons, and gluons.

A neutron is a neutral subatomic particle found within the nucleus of an atom. It has no electric charge but contributes to the mass of the atom. Neutrons help stabilize the nucleus by balancing the repulsive forces between positively charged protons.
